Sour Maui is a sativa-dominant hybrid born from two legendary cannabis lineages, Sour Diesel and Maui Wowie. This cross delivers an energetic cerebral rush paired with a distinctive tropical-diesel aroma that sets it apart from other sativa hybrids on the market. Designed for daytime use, Sour Maui fuels creativity, social engagement, and focused productivity without the heavy sedation associated with indica strains. Home growers appreciate its vigorous growth and generous resin production, while consumers return for the uplifting euphoria and complex flavor. Feminized seeds are widely available, making this cultivar accessible to both novice and experienced gardeners looking for a reliable sativa experience.
Sour Diesel emerged on the East Coast of the United States during the early 1990s and quickly became one of the most sought-after sativa-leaning cultivars in modern cannabis history. Its hallmark traits include a pungent fuel-forward aroma, a fast-hitting cerebral high, and THC levels that routinely exceed 20 percent. Breeders value Sour Diesel for the consistency it brings to crosses, reliably passing on its energetic psychoactive character and dense, elongated bud structure to offspring.
Maui Wowie represents the other half of the Sour Maui equation, tracing its roots to the volcanic soils of Hawaii where it gained fame during the 1970s counterculture movement. This tropical landrace delivers a light, euphoric effect accompanied by sweet pineapple and citrus terpenes that evoke island breezes. Its natural resilience to heat and humidity makes it an excellent genetic donor for outdoor-friendly hybrids, and it consistently transmits those tropical aromatic notes to the next generation.
Crossing two sativa-dominant parents produces a hybrid that leans heavily toward sativa expression, typically settling around 70 to 80 percent sativa genetics. The resulting F1 generation benefits from hybrid vigor, displaying uniform growth patterns and predictable cannabinoid output. Most phenotypes exhibit tall, branchy architecture with long internodal spacing, though careful breeding has stabilized the line enough that extreme variation is uncomon when sourcing from reputable seed banks.
Among sativa-dominant hybrids, Sour Maui occupies a unique niche by combining the raw power of Sour Diesel with the smooth tropical finish of Maui Wowie. Unlike pure landrace sativas that can flower for 16 weeks or more, this hybrid finishes in a more manageable timeframe while retaining the soaring cerebral effect that sativa enthusiasts demand. The pairing of diesel pungency with fruity sweetness creates a flavor profile rarely found in other Sour Diesel crosses, giving Sour Maui a distinct identity in a crowded market.
Laboratory testing of Sour Maui flowers consistently shows THC concentrations between 20 and 26 percent, placing this cultivar firmly in the high-potency category. CBD content remains negligible, typically registering below one percent, which means the psychoactive experience is dominated by THC without significant cannabidiol modulation. Potency can fluctuate by two to three percentage points depending on phenotype selection and environmental factors such as light intensity and nutrient availability during the flowering phase.
The terpene profile is led by limonene, which contributes bright citrus and tropical fruit aromas while supporting mood elevation. Myrcene appears at moderate levels, adding a layer of mango-like sweetness and providing subtle body relaxation that prevents the high from feeling overly racy. Caryophyllene rounds out the dominant trio with peppery, spicy undertones and interacts directly with CB2 receptors, potentially offering mild anti-inflammatory benefits that complement the overall entourage effect.
The aromatic experience of Sour Maui unfolds in distinct layers. The first impression upon opening a jar is an unmistakable diesel fuel note inherited from Sour Diesel, sharp and acrid in the best possible way. As the buds are broken apart, a middle layer of tropical fruit emerges, reminiscent of ripe mango and papaya, before settling into an earthy, slightly spicy base note that lingers in the room. During flowering, the plants produce an intense odor that demands carbon filtration for indoor discretion.
When consumed through a vaporizer at temperatures between 175 and 195 degrees Celsius, the tropical terpenes shine brightest, delivering a smooth citrus inhale with a tangy exhale. Combustion at higher temperatures brings out more of the diesel character and adds a slightly acrid edge to the smoke. Proper curing for four to eight weeks dramatically improves flavor smoothness, allowing the full spectrum of terpenes to express without harshness, and consumers frequently note a lingering citrus-sour aftertaste that distinguishes Sour Maui from other strains.
Trace amounts of minor cannabinoids including CBG and CBC appear in Sour Maui flowers, generally below 0.5 percent each. While these compounds exist in small quantities, researchers believe they contribute to the overall entourage effect by modulating how THC interacts with the endocannabinoid system. This cannabinoid profile positions Sour Maui squarely as a recreational cultivar rather than a therapeutic CBD strain, best suited for consumers seeking potent psychoactive effects paired with complex flavor.
Terpene preservation depends heavily on post-harvest handling and storage conditions. Exposure to temperatures above 25 degrees Celsius or direct light accelerates terpene evaporation and converts THC into the more sedative CBN over time. Storing cured buds in airtight glass containers at15 to 20 degrees Celsius with relative humidity maintained between 58 and 62 percent ensures the aromatic and cannabinoid profile remains intact for six months or longer. Vacuum sealing provides additional protection for long-term storage beyond that window.

The onset of Sour Maui hits within five to ten minutes of inhalation, beginning as a wave of cerebral clarity and euphoria that lifts mood almost immediately. Energy levels rise noticeably, accompanied by heightened sensory awareness and a desire to engage with the surrounding environment. Over the next 30 to 60 minutes the effect stabilizes into a sustained state of motivated focus, and the total duration typically spans two to three hours before tapering gently without a crash or heavy sedation.
Creative professionals frequently cite Sour Maui as a go-to cultivar for artistic work, noting that it loosens mental blocks and encourages free-flowing ideation. The social dimension is equally pronounced, with users reporting increased talkativeness and a genuine enjoyment of conversation that makes it suitable for gatherings. Some consumers compare the stimulation to a strong cup of coffee but with added warmth and emotional openess, making it a functional choice for daytime productivity without the jitteriness caffeine can produce.
Overconsumption of high-THC sativas like Sour Maui can trigger anxiety or racing thoughts, particularly in individuals with low tolerance or predisposition to paranoia. Dry mouth and dry eyes are the most common mild side effects and are easily managed with hydration. Beginers should start with one or two inhalations and wait fifteen minutes before consuming more, allowing the rapid onset to fully manifest before deciding on additional doses.
Morning and early afternoon represent the optimal consumption window for Sour Maui, aligning its energetic character with periods of natural wakefulness. The strain pairs exceptionally well with outdoor activities where physical movement and sensory engagement amplify the euphoric effect. Using Sour Maui in the evening or before bed is generally discouraged because the cerebral stimulation can interfere with sleep onset and reduce overall rest quality.
Indoor cultivation of Sour Maui performs well in both soil and hydroponic systems, though soil tends to enhancerpene complexity while hydroponics accelerates growth speed. Containers of 15 to 20 liters provide adequate root space for the vigorous sativa root system, and fabric pots improve oxygenation and prevent root circling. Maintain pH between 6.0 and 6.5 in soil or 5.5 to 6.0 in hydro, with electrical conductivity starting at 1.2 mS/cm during vegetation and rising to 1.8 mS/cm in peak flower.
An 18/6 light schedule during vegetation promotes strong structural development over four to six weeks before flipping to 12/12 to initiate flowering. LED panels delivering 600 to 900PPFD at canopy level produce optimal photosynthesis rates without excessive heat buildup. Position lights30 to 45 centimeters above the tallest growth tip and adjust weekly as the plant stretches. The full seed-to-harvest cycle runs 16 to 20 weeks depending on vegetative duration and phenotype flowering speed.
Sativa-dominant hybrids like Sour Maui commonly stretch100 to 150 percent in height during the first three weeks of flowering, creating significant vertical management challenges indoors. Low Stress Training involves gently bending and tying branches horizontally to create an even canopy that receives uniform light distribution. A SCRoG net installed40 centimeters above the pot rim guides branches through the mesh during late vegetation, and growers should begin tucking shoots beneath the net two weeks before the flip to 12/12.
Topping the main stem above the fourth or fifth node during week three of vegetation creates two dominant colas and encourages lateral branching. FIM cuts remove approximately 80 percent of the new growth tip, producing three to four new shoots from a single cut. Supercropping, which involves pinching and bending stems until the inner fibers partially break, works well on stuborn vertical branches that resist LST. Combining these methods can increase final yield by 20 to 30 percent compared to untrained plants.
Switching to 12/12 earlier than usual, after just three to four weeks of vegetation, is another effective strategy for height management in limited vertical spaces. Calculate expected final height by multiplying the plant height at flip by 2.5 to account for stretch. A minimum ceiling clearance of 180 centimeters is recommended after accounting for pot height, light fixture distance, and plant growth. When growing from regular seeds, selecting the most compact phenotypes during early vegetation allows growers to cull excessively tall individuals before they consume valuable canopy space.
Daytime temperatures between 22 and 28 degrees Celsius paired with a nightime drop to 18 to 22 degrees Celsius create ideal metabolic conditions for Sour Maui. Relative humidity should remain at 60 to 70 percent during vegetation and decrease to 40 to 50 percent once flowers begin forming to minimize mold risk. Maintaining proper Vapor Pressure Deficit between 0.8 and 1.2 kPa ensures efficient transpiration, and oscillating fans positioned below and above the canopy prevent microclimates from developing around dense bud sites.
Nutrient requirements follow a standard sativa feeding pattern with elevated nitrogen during vegetative growth transitioning to phosphorus and potassium dominance once flowering begins. Sour Maui shows moderate sensitivity to overfeeding, so starting at 75 percent of manufacturer-recommended doses and increasing based on plant response prevents nutrient burn. A plain water flush during the final10 to 14 days before harvest removes residual salts from the growing medium and improves the smoothness and flavor of the finished product.
Sour Maui thrives in warm Mediterranean or tropical climates where daytime temperatures consistently exceed 20 degrees Celsius throughout the growing season. The strain requires a long summer with harvest typically falling in late October to mid-November in the Northern Hemisphere, making it best suited for latitudes between 25 and 40 degrees north. Growers in cooler or shorter-season regions can extend viability by using a greenhouse or hoop house that traps heat and protects against early autumn rains. Select a planting site that receives at least eight hours of direct sunlight daily with natural wind protection from hedges or fencing.
Soil preparation begins four to six weeks before transplanting with generous additions of aged compost, perlite for drainage, and mycorrhizal inoculant to boost root nutrient uptake. Planting holes or raised beds should provide at least 75 liters of amended soil volume per plant to support the extensive root system sativas develop. Watering frequency varies from every two to three days during vegetation to daily during peak flowering in hot weather, with deep soaking preferred over frequent shallow irrigation. Mulching with straw or wood chips conserves moisture, suppresses weeds, and maintains stable root zone temperatures.
Outdoor Sour Maui plants can reach 200 to 300 centimeters in height when allowed to grow freely, producing massive canopies that intercept maximum sunlight. Topping the main stem once or twice during June controls vertical growth and encourages a bushier structure with multiple main colas. Heavy branches laden with dense flowers benefit from bamboo stakes or trellis netting to prevent snapping during wind events or under their own weight. Beginning structural support installation early flowering prevents damage to branches that have already set buds.
Botrytis gray mold represents the primary threat to outdoor Sour Maui crops, particularly in regions where autumn brings cool nights and morning dew. Preventive measures include spacing plants at least 1.5 meters apart for airflow, removing interior fan leaves that trap moisture, and inspecting dense colas daily during the final weeks. Organic pest management with neem oil controls spider mites and aphids, while Bacillus thuringiensis sprays eliminate caterpillars that bore into buds. Harvest timing should coincide with a dry weather window of at least three consecutive days to minimize moisture content in freshly cut flowers.

Flowering duration for Sour Maui runs10 to 12 weeks from the switch to 12/12 lighting, which is typical for sativa-dominant genetics but longer than most indica hybrids. A vegetative phase of four to six weeks indoors provides sufficient structural development to support heavy flower production without unnecessarily extending the total cycle. From seed to harvest, growers should plan for 16 to 20 weeks total, with the shorter end achievable through early topping and aggressive training that builds canopy width rather than height during a compressed vegetative period.
Indoor yields of 400 to 500 grams per square meter are realistic under optimized conditions including high-output LED lighting, proper training, and attentive nutrient management. Outdoor plants receiving full sun throughout the season can produce 500 to 700 grams per individual plant, with exceptional specimens in ideal climates exceding that range. First-time growers should set expectations at roughly 70 percent of these figures while they learn the specific feeding and environmental preferences of the cultivar, then scale up in subsequent cycles as technique improves.
Trichome observation provides the most reliable indicator of peak maturity for Sour Maui. Using a jeweler's loupe at 60x magnification or a USB digital microscope, examine trichome heads on multiple bud sites across the plant. For the energetic, cerebral effect that defines this strain, harvest when approximately 70 percent of trichome heads appear milky white with the remaining 30 percent still clear. Check daily during the final two weeks because trichome maturation can accelerate rapidly in the last days before peak.
Visual cues complement trichome analysis and help confirm readiness. Fan leaves begin yellowing as the plant redirects nutrients into flower production, calyxes swell noticeably, and 70 to 80 percent of pistils darken and curl inward. Harvesting earlier preserves more of the uplifting sativa character, while waiting for amber trichomes shifts the effect toward sedation. A 48-hour dark period before cutting remains debated among growers, but proponents claim it encourages a final burst of resin production as the plant responds to perceived seasonal change.
Drying should occur in a dark room at 18 to 21 degrees Celsius with relative humidity between 55 and 65 percent, taking 7 to 14 days until small stems snap cleanly rather than bending. Rushing this process with fans or heat destroys volatile terpenes and produces harsh smoke regardless of how well the plant was grown. Curing in glass mason jars for a minimum of two weeks, ideally four to eight weeks, allows chlorophyll to break down and terpene profiles to mature. Open jars for 10 to 15 minutes daily during the first week, then reduce to every two to three days as moisture stabilizes.
The most common harvest mistakes with Sour Maui involve impatience and improper post-harvest handling. Cutting too early based solely on pistil color without trichome verification leaves significant potency and weight on the table. Insufficient drying followed by jaring creates anaerobic conditions that invite mold, while skipping the cure entirely results in a harsh, grassy taste that masks the complexerpene profile. Boveda humidity packs rated at 62 percent placed inside cure jars provide passive moisture regulation and eliminate the guesswork from long-term storage.
Feminized seeds represent the most popular choice for home growers cultivating Sour Maui because they eliminate the need to identify and remove male plants, ensuring every seed produces a flowering female. Regular seeds appeal to breeders and experienced cultivators interested in phenotype hunting or creating new crosses, though they require sexing during early flowering. Autoflower versions offer a compressed lifecycle of 10 to 13 weeks from seed but typically sacrifice15 to 20 percent of the photoperiod version's potency and yield potential.
High-quality cannabis seeds display a dark brown or gray coloration with a hard outer shell and often feature a subtle tiger-stripe pattern. Seeds that crack under gentle pressure between fingers are immature or improperly stored and unlikely to germinate successfully. Store unused seeds in a cool, dark location at 6 to 8 degrees Celsius with low humidity, where they remain viable for three to five years. Reputable sellers offer germination guarantees of 80to 95 percent, providing replacements for seeds that fail to sprout under proper conditions.
The paper towel method remains the most popular germination technique, involving placement of seeds between moist paper towels inside a sealed container at 22 to 25 degrees Celsius. Taprots typically emerge within 24 to 72 hours, at which point seedlings transfer to their growing medium with the root pointing downward at a depth of one centimeter. The first48 hours after sprouting require gentle light at 200 to 300 PPFD, high humidity around 70 percent, and temperatures near 24 degrees Celsius to prevent shock and encourage rapid establishment.
When selecting a seed vendor, prioritize those with documented genetic lineage information and transparent breeding practices. Customer reviews that specifically mention Sour Maui phenotype consistency and germination success provide more useful insight than generic store ratings. Discreet shipping in crush-proof packaging protects seeds during transit, and secure payment options including cryptocurrency offer additional privacy for buyers in regions with ambiguous cannabis seed legislation.

Within the sativa-dominant hybrid category, Sour Maui competes with several established cultivars including its own parent strains, Super Lemon Haze, and Jack Herer. Each strain serves a slightly different consumer preference, whether that involves flavor complexity, growing difficulty, or the specific character of the cerebral effect. Comparing these options across multiple parameters helps buyers identify which cultivar best matches their personal goals and cultivation capabilities.
Against pure Sour Diesel, Sour Maui delivers a softer onset with less likelihood of triggering anxiety in sensitive users, thanks to the moderating influence of Maui Wowie genetics. The tropical terpene layer adds aromatic complexity absent from straight Sour Diesel, which leans entirely into fuel and chemical notes. Compared to pure Maui Wowie, the hybrid offers substantially higher THC content, typically five to eight percentage points above the landrace parent, along with improved yield and shorter flowering time that make it more practical for modern indoor cultivation.
Super Lemon Haze shares the energetic sativa character but diverges significantly in terpene expression, emphasizing sharp lemon and candy sweetness rather than the diesel-tropical combination found in Sour Maui. Growing difficulty is comparable between the two, though Super Lemon Haze tends to stretch slightly more agressively. Jack Herer provides a more focused, intellectual high compared to the broader creative energy of Sour Maui, and its piney, earthy flavor profile appeals to consumers who find diesel notes overwhelming. Seed pricing across all four cultivars falls within a similar range at reputable vendors.
Sour Maui represents the ideal choice for growers who want sativa energy without the extreme flowering times and unmanageable heights of pure landrace genetics. Consumers transitioning from indica-dominant strains find it an accessible entry point into sativa territory because the Maui Wowie influence softens the sometimes aggressive Sour Diesel stimulation. For garden diversity, pairing Sour Maui with a complementary indica hybrid creates a well-rounded personal supply covering both daytime productivity and evening relaxation needs.
